2024-10-26
想象一下,你打开Netflix,在最喜欢的节目中浏览,并立即找到想要观看的内容。没有延迟、没有缓冲,只有纯粹的视听享受。这种流畅体验并非魔法——它来自于幕后工作的强大技术:分布式数据库。
Netflix需要同时服务于数百万用户,每个用户都可能流媒体播放不同的内容,并且速度也不尽相同。单个集中式数据库无法处理这个巨大的负载,而不会出现性能瓶颈和令人沮丧的延迟。相反,Netflix使用 分布式数据库,数据分散存储在多个互联服务器上。这使他们能够:
分布式数据库的崛起:超越Netflix
Netflix并非孤例。如今,许多企业都在转向分布式数据库来满足其不断变化的需求。从处理每天数百万笔交易的电子商务巨头到管理海量用户数据的社交媒体平台,这些优势是不可否认的。
塑造未来:新兴技术
分布式数据库的世界正在不断发展,令人兴奋的新技术正在突破界限:
选择合适的解决方案:
在如此多选项中,选择适合您业务的合适分布式数据库需要仔细考虑。应考虑到数据量、性能要求、可扩展性需求以及预算限制等因素。
结论: 数据的未来管理方式无疑是分布式的。通过采用这些新兴技术,企业可以解锁更高水平的性能、可扩展性和弹性,从而使其能够在不断变化的数字环境中蓬勃发展。
以下是一个基于上述文本的真实案例:
Spotify和分布式数据库:
就像Netflix一样,Spotify也依赖分布式数据库来为全球数百万用户无缝提供音乐流媒体服务。
Spotify 的益处:
这个例子证明了对于需要处理大量数据、提供实时服务和扩展以满足不断增长的需求的现代企业来说,分布式数据库是必不可少的。
## 分布式数据库优势:Netflix vs Spotify
特征 | Netflix | Spotify |
---|---|---|
核心业务 | 视频流媒体服务 | 音乐流媒体服务 |
数据量 | 海量的视频文件、用户观看记录、元数据 | 海量的歌曲库、用户收听历史、音乐信息 |
用户规模 | 数百万 | 数亿 |
分布式数据库优势 | 轻松扩展以满足用户高峰期需求,确保高可用性即使单个服务器故障,优化性能通过将数据存储在用户地理位置更近的地方减少延迟 | 高度可扩展性来处理不断增长的用户群和歌曲库,可靠的服务确保无中断的音乐播放体验,个性化推荐功能依赖于对大量用户的实时数据分析 |
额外优势 | 个性化体验:提供精准的影视推荐、支持多语言配音 |